Product Selection Differences for Fastener Making Machinery

When selecting fastener making machinery, there are several key differences to consider:

  1. Type of Fasteners Produced: Different machines are designed to produce different types of fasteners such as screws, bolts, rivets, and nuts. Choose a machine that is suitable for the specific type of fastener you intend to manufacture.

  2. Production Capacity: Consider the production volume you require. Some machines are designed for high-speed production and high volumes, while others are more suited for smaller production runs.

  3. Automation Level: Automation can improve efficiency and reduce labor costs. Evaluate the level of automation offered by the machinery, including features like automatic feed systems, sorting mechanisms, and quality control.

  4. Precision and Quality: Look for machines that can consistently produce fasteners with high precision and quality. This is crucial to meet industry standards and ensure the reliability of the fasteners.

  5. Flexibility and Versatility: Some machines are more versatile and can be easily reconfigured to produce different types or sizes of fasteners. Consider the flexibility of the machine to accommodate changing production needs.

  6. Ease of Operation and Maintenance: Choose machinery that is user-friendly and easy to maintain to minimize downtime and operational issues. Training requirements for operators should also be taken into consideration.

  7. Cost and Return on Investment: Evaluate the initial investment cost of the machinery and compare it with the potential return on investment based on your production requirements and market demand.

  8. Supplier Reputation and Support: Select a reputable supplier with a track record of providing quality machinery and reliable customer support. Consider factors like warranty, spare parts availability, and technical assistance.

By carefully considering these factors, you can choose the most suitable fastener making machinery for your specific needs and maximize the efficiency and effectiveness of your production processes.
